Series Deep Dive:

Originally debuting as a Spanish-British co-production, Pocoyo redefined preschool programming through its minimalist aesthetic and innovative use of Softimage XSI 3D technology. Set against a stark white void, the series stripped away visual clutter to focus entirely on the curiosity of its titular toddler and his animal companions. This void-space design served a dual purpose: it focused child attention on character expression and allowed the show to transcend linguistic barriers, leading to its global acquisition by HBO Max. Stephen Fry's warm narration provided a bridge between the audience and the screen, fostering an interactive environment. The show remains a landmark in early childhood education for its ability to convey complex emotional intelligence through simple, pantomime-driven storytelling and high-contrast animation.

Creative Pulse - Irregular Series

Creative Engine: Guillermo García Carsí

Pocoyo operates on the Guillermo García Carsí timeline, where creative readiness supersedes broadcast schedules. Since its debut in 2005, the series has famously ignored the traditional annual release cycle common in preschool television. Long hiatuses between the early seasons and the eventual revival for the fourth installment proved that Zinkia Entertainment prioritizes technological upgrades and global distribution rights over rapid-fire production. This deliberate pace ensures that the minimalist aesthetic and educational integrity remain intact across decades.

Fans have learned to trade predictability for quality, understanding that the blue-clad toddler returns only when the animation techniques and storytelling are perfected for a new generation of viewers.

The long hiatuses are primarily due to the show's complex production history, including changes in ownership and the high level of creative oversight required for its unique minimalist style. Additionally, the transition to new animation software and the return of original creator Guillermo García Carsí to lead a creative renaissance have historically extended development timelines.

As of 2023, the French-based studio Animaj acquired the rights to Pocoyo from Zinkia Entertainment and now manages the series. Original creator Guillermo García Carsí has returned as Creative Director to oversee the new seasons, including the introduction of Pocoyo's sister, Bea.
